Wyoming Forcible Entry and Detainer, Statutory Overview
Proceedings for forcible entry and detainer (eviction) in Wyoming are governed by Wyo. Stat. §§ 1-21-1001 through 1-21-1016. A written notice to quit is required before commencing an action in Circuit Court. For nonpayment of rent or certain violations, a three (3) day notice is used. Formal eviction requires court order and sheriff enforcement. Self-help eviction (changing locks, shutting off utilities, removing personal property, or threats) is prohibited and exposes the landlord to liability under Wyoming law.
Important: This notice is a prerequisite only. It does not itself terminate possession or authorize removal of the tenant. The landlord must file a complaint for forcible entry and detainer in the Circuit Court of the county where the premises is located after the notice period expires without cure or payment. The sheriff serves the summons and executes any writ of restitution.
Notice Type Selection Table
| Ground | Notice Type | Cure/Pay Period | Governing Statute |
|---|---|---|---|
| , , | , , , - | , , , , - | , , , , , - |
| Nonpayment of rent | 3-Day Notice to Pay Rent or Quit | 3 days to pay | Wyo. Stat. § 1-21-1002(a)(i); § 1-21-1003 |
| Material lease violation (remediable) | 3-Day Notice to Cure or Quit | 3 days to cure | Wyo. Stat. § 1-21-1002; § 1-21-1003 |
| Holdover after lease expiration or termination | 3-Day Notice to Quit | None | Wyo. Stat. § 1-21-1002(a)(i) |
| Other unlawful detainer grounds (e.g., waste, nuisance, denial of access) | 3-Day Unconditional Quit or as specified | As applicable | Wyo. Stat. §§ 1-21-1002 through 1-21-1003 |
Service of the notice to quit: The notice shall be served at least three (3) days before commencing the action by leaving a written copy with the defendant or at the defendant's usual place of abode or business if the defendant cannot be found (Wyo. Stat. § 1-21-1003)., -

Date Computation and Service Notes (Wyo. Stat. § 1-21-1003)
The three-day notice period begins the day after proper service. If served by leaving at abode, it is effective upon leaving. Weekends and holidays may affect court filing but the statutory three days are calendar days unless otherwise ordered. Always allow extra time for mailing if used in combination with posting. Retain proof of service (signed affidavit or process server return) for court filing.
Court Filing Summary
After the notice period expires without compliance:
- File Summons and Complaint (Forcible Entry and Detainer) in the Circuit Court of the county where the property is located.
- Pay applicable filing fees.
- Arrange for sheriff or authorized process server to serve the tenant (typically 3-12 days before hearing per local practice).
- Attend hearing; if judgment granted, obtain Writ of Restitution for sheriff execution.
- No self-help actions are permitted at any stage., -

Common mistakes
- ×Wrong notice period for the jurisdiction
- ×demanding amounts not legally recoverable
- ×no proof-of-service section
- ×using as a self-help eviction (it's only the predicate to filing)
